Green driving has surged past a new milestone after Austrian economy motoring specialist Gerhard Plattner drove 1,246 miles on one 45-litre tank of fuel.

Plattner, who travelled in a Skoda Fabia GreenLine, drove from Reutte, Austria, to Bov in Denmark, and back again - a record low of 127.8 miles-per-gallon. He used Germany's longest motorway, the A7, for his trip.

The International Police Motor Corporation supervised the journey, sealing the fuel tank before Plattner set off.

The driver said: "The Skoda GreenLine models are perfect for fuel-efficient driving. In light of the current fuel prices not only is that important for one's own wallet, but also for lowering environmental pollution.

With a fuel consumption well below the specified norm I want to show that besides the car manufacturers, every driver can contribute to further reduce this environmental pollution."
